No description
Find a file
Giuseppe Caizzone 69c4feebb1 Add generic logical block size support for UDF.
* grub-core/fs/udf.c (GRUB_UDF_LOG2_BLKSIZE): Removed.
	(GRUB_UDF_BLKSZ): Removed.
	(struct grub_udf_data): New field "lbshift" to hold the logical	block
	size of the file system in log2 format. All users updated.
	(sblocklist): Change type to unsigned.
	(grub_udf_mount): Change type of "sblklist" to unsigned.
	Move AVDP search before VRS recognition, because the latter requires
	knowledge of the logical block size, which is detected during the
	former.
	Detect and validate logical block size during AVDP search, adding
	support for block sizes 512, 1024 and 4096.
	Make VRS recognition independent of block size.
2010-11-14 17:03:49 +01:00
build-aux Use gnulib-tool to create gnulib source files. 2010-09-20 12:35:33 +02:00
conf 2010-11-07 Robert Millan <rmh@gnu.org> 2010-11-07 16:29:10 +01:00
docs * docs/grub.texi (Changes from GRUB Legacy): Note when save_env is 2010-11-14 16:25:28 +01:00
grub-core Add generic logical block size support for UDF. 2010-11-14 17:03:49 +01:00
include 2010-11-08 Manoel Rebelo Abranches <mrabran@br.ibm.com> 2010-11-08 11:14:54 -02:00
m4 Fix po directory handling. 2010-09-21 00:09:23 +01:00
po Fix po directory handling. 2010-09-21 00:09:23 +01:00
tests suppress shell expansion inside quoted strings 2010-11-07 16:13:14 +05:30
unicode Add lost unicode LICENSE 2010-03-30 14:21:48 +02:00
util * util/grub-install.in: Ignore empty partition table detection 2010-11-14 16:15:41 +01:00
.bzrignore Re-enable grub-extras. 2010-09-24 09:48:27 +01:00
ABOUT-NLS automake commit without merge history 2010-05-06 11:34:04 +05:30
acinclude.m4 Split config.h for util and core. 2010-09-19 22:22:43 +02:00
AUTHORS 2005-09-03 Yoshinori K. Okuji <okuji@enbug.org> 2005-09-03 16:54:27 +00:00
autogen.sh Re-enable grub-extras. 2010-09-24 09:48:27 +01:00
ChangeLog Add generic logical block size support for UDF. 2010-11-14 16:58:50 +01:00
config.h.in Keep boot and grub directory names in sync with utils scripts 2010-09-21 11:42:30 +02:00
configure.ac 2010-11-07 Robert Millan <rmh@gnu.org> 2010-11-07 16:29:10 +01:00
COPYING 2007-07-22 Yoshinori K. Okuji <okuji@enbug.org> 2007-07-21 23:32:33 +00:00
geninit.sh automake commit without merge history 2010-05-06 11:34:04 +05:30
gentpl.py Put terminfo into core on ieee1275 and yeeloong (needed for console). 2010-09-30 17:50:01 +02:00
INSTALL * INSTALL: Document that libdevmapper needs to be 1.02.34 or later. 2010-09-02 23:57:21 +01:00
Makefile.am * Makefile.am (libgrub.pp): Propagate the libgrub.a split. 2010-11-01 12:29:20 +01:00
Makefile.util.def renamed libemu and libgrub to libgrubkern and libgrubmods respectively 2010-10-29 14:44:25 +05:30
NEWS * grub-core/commands/efi/lsefimmap.c: Correct header. 2010-09-20 17:59:09 +01:00
README * README: Point to the Info manual. 2010-07-13 12:20:32 +01:00
THANKS 2009-12-11 Robert Millan <rmh.grub@aybabtu.com> 2009-12-11 22:44:47 +00:00
TODO 2008-01-07 Robert Millan <rmh@aybabtu.com> 2008-01-07 19:21:34 +00:00

This is GRUB 2, the second version of the GRand Unified Bootloader.
GRUB 2 is rewritten from scratch to make GNU GRUB cleaner, safer, more
robust, more powerful, and more portable.

See the file NEWS for a description of recent changes to GRUB 2.

See the file INSTALL for instructions on how to build and install the
GRUB 2 data and program files.

Please visit the official web page of GRUB 2, for more information.
The URL is <http://www.gnu.org/software/grub/grub.html>.

More extensive documentation is available in the Info manual,
accessible using 'info grub' after building and installing GRUB 2.
Please look at the GRUB Wiki <http://grub.enbug.org> for testing
procedures.

There are a number of important user-visible differences from the
first version of GRUB, now known as GRUB Legacy. For a summary, please
see:

  info grub Introduction 'Changes from GRUB Legacy'